Why Your Coolant Reservoir Needs Cleaning
Let’s talk about what your coolant reservoir actually does. This clear plastic tank holds extra coolant (also called antifreeze) that your engine needs to stay cool. As your engine runs, the radiator and water pump push coolant through the engine block to absorb all that intense heat. The hot coolant then flows to your radiator where it cools down before heading back for another round.
Here’s the thing: dirt finds its way in. Over time, sediment builds up at the bottom of the reservoir. Your coolant breaks down. Rust particles settle in. Algae can even grow in there if you’re not paying attention. All of this gunk makes your cooling system work harder than it should.
When your cooling system gets gunked up, several bad things happen. Your engine temperature creeps upward. Heat transfer becomes less efficient. Your water pump has to work overtime. The radiator can’t cool things down as fast. In the worst cases, you end up with an overheated engine, blown head gaskets, and repair bills that hurt.
Cleaning your coolant reservoir gives your whole cooling system a fresh start. Better heat dissipation means better engine performance. Your engine runs cooler. Your fuel economy improves. You stop worrying about overheating on hot days or during traffic jams.
What You’ll Need Before You Start
Grab these supplies before you get under the hood. Having everything ready makes the job go faster and keeps you from making unnecessary trips to the store.
Safety gear matters first. Get yourself a pair of thick work gloves. Engine coolant isn’t something you want on your skin. Grab some safety glasses too. You don’t want coolant splashing in your eyes. A respirator mask is smart if you have respiratory issues, though it’s not always necessary.
Tools and containers come next. You need a socket set or wrench set to remove bolts and hose clamps. A bucket holds old coolant that you’ll drain out. Get yourself a turkey baster or old syringe for small jobs. Rags and paper towels do cleanup. Compressed air helps blast out stubborn gunk.
Cleaning supplies round out your kit. Distilled water gets the job done perfectly. Some people use a coolant flush product designed for this exact job. White vinegar works in a pinch for light cleaning. Antifreeze disposal bags come in handy for old fluid storage.
New coolant is essential. Don’t reuse the old stuff you drain out. Fresh coolant has better additives and corrosion inhibitors. Pick the right type for your car. Most vehicles need either green, orange, pink, or blue coolant. Check your owner’s manual to be sure.
Preparing Your Vehicle for Cleaning
Safety first, always. Park your car on a level surface. Let your engine cool completely. Hot coolant burns like crazy. Never work on your cooling system when the engine is warm. Wait a minimum of an hour after your last drive.
Locate your coolant reservoir in the engine bay. It’s usually a white or translucent plastic tank near the radiator. You can see the fluid level through the sides. Most reservoirs have a cap with a little vent hole. Some have a pressure valve built in.
Open your hood and look around. Trace the hoses connected to the reservoir. Follow them to see where they lead. Notice the clamps that hold everything together. You’ll need to work with these later.
Take a photo with your phone before you start draining anything. Seriously. This reference shot helps you remember exactly how everything connects. It’s super useful when you’re putting things back together.
Read your owner’s manual for your specific car. Different vehicles have slightly different setups. Some have drain plugs on the reservoir itself. Others require you to loosen hose clamps and pull hoses off. Knowing your car’s design saves you from fumbling around.
The Draining Process
This step gets messy, so dress for it. Put on your work gloves and position your bucket underneath the reservoir. Take your time here.
If your reservoir has a drain plug at the bottom, unscrew it slowly. Let all the old coolant flow into the bucket. Don’t rush this. The cooler fluid flows out first. Then the sediment and gunk come pouring out. That gross stuff is exactly why you’re doing this.
If your reservoir doesn’t have a drain plug, you’ll loosen the hose clamps at the top or bottom of the tank. Grab your socket wrench and turn the clamp bolts counterclockwise. Once the clamp loosens, gently pull the hose away. Coolant flows out into your bucket. Have plenty of rags ready.
Some vehicles have a coolant drain on the radiator itself, separate from the reservoir. You might need to drain that too. Check where all your hoses go. The goal is getting out every drop of old coolant.
Let everything drain for several minutes. Tilt the reservoir gently if you can to get the last of the fluid out. Patience pays off here because you want to remove as much of the gunk as possible.
Rinsing Out the Reservoir
Now comes the actual cleaning part. Pour distilled water into the empty reservoir through the top opening. Fill it halfway. Screw the cap back on or have a friend hold a rag over the opening.
Shake the reservoir vigorously. Get the water splashing around inside. This agitation breaks up settled sediment and washes away rust particles. Shake hard for at least thirty seconds. You’ll feel the debris swirling inside.
Pour out all the water into your bucket. You’ll probably see murky, discolored water. That’s the crud coming out. Repeat this rinsing process until the water comes out clear. Most cars need three to five rinses. Some really gunked-up reservoirs might need more.
For stubborn buildup, use the white vinegar trick. Pour vinegar into the reservoir with some water. Let it sit for fifteen minutes. The acidity helps dissolve rust and mineral deposits. Then shake and rinse as before. This works wonders on discolored interiors.
Once the water runs crystal clear, you’re done rinsing. The inside should look bright and clean. Any remaining sediment has been flushed away. Your cooling system is ready for fresh coolant.
Cleaning the Reservoir Cap and Overflow Tube
Don’t forget these small but important parts. The reservoir cap contains a pressure valve that regulates cooling system pressure. Over time, mineral buildup clogs this vent hole. A clogged cap messes with your entire cooling system.
Remove the cap and look inside. Use your turkey baster to spray distilled water through the vent hole. Blast out any debris. If it’s really stuck, soak the cap in white vinegar for thirty minutes. Then rinse thoroughly.
Check the overflow tube while you’re at it. This small rubber hose sits between the reservoir cap and the engine. Sometimes sediment clogs this tube. Run distilled water through it using your baster. You want water to flow freely.
Dry everything with clean rags before reassembly. Moisture sitting inside causes rust to return faster than you’d like.
Putting Everything Back Together
This is where that reference photo you took becomes your best friend. Look at it and start reconnecting hoses in the exact same order.
Reconnect your hoses to the reservoir if you removed them. Push them firmly onto the fittings. They should click or seat fully. Then tighten your hose clamps. Use your socket wrench to turn the clamp bolts clockwise. Tighten them snug but not crazy tight. You can crack plastic if you over-tighten.
If your reservoir had a drain plug, screw it back in. Tighten it by hand first, then use your wrench for a final quarter turn. You don’t want leaks starting immediately after all your hard work.
Reattach any wires or sensor connectors you disconnected. Screw the reservoir cap back on. Sit back and look everything over. Does it look like the photo you took? Everything connected properly? Good.
Filling with Fresh Coolant
Now for the good stuff: new, clean coolant. Grab the correct type for your vehicle. Remember, colors matter. Green, orange, pink, and blue aren’t just for looks. They have different chemical formulas.
Open the reservoir cap. You can usually just twist it counterclockwise. Some cars have a secondary coolant overflow bottle separate from the main reservoir. Fill both.
Pour slowly and steadily. Watch the level rise toward the fill line. There’s usually a MIN and MAX mark on the side. Fill it to the MAX line. You want plenty of coolant available for the engine to use.
Leave the cap off for now. Start your engine and let it run at idle. Watch as the thermostat opens and coolant flows through the engine. The level will probably drop. Let it cool, then add more coolant until you reach the MAX line again.
Some air gets trapped in the cooling system. This air gets pushed out as the engine warms up. That’s totally normal. After your engine cools completely, check the level one more time and top off if needed.
Screw the cap back on once you’re satisfied with the level. You’re done!
Testing Your Work
Drive your car and watch the temperature gauge. It should stabilize right in the middle of the hot and cold zones. No sudden spikes. No warnings lights on your dashboard.
After ten minutes of driving, pull over carefully and feel the radiator hose. It should be hot but not scalding. The heat should feel even. Any cold spots mean coolant isn’t flowing properly.
Let your engine cool and check the fluid level again. It should stay right where you left it. Leaks show up immediately. Look under your car when parked. Any puddles? Any drips? If yes, retighten your hose clamps or drain plug.
After a few days of regular driving, pop the hood again and inspect everything. Make sure your connections are still tight. Your cooling system should be running smoothly now.
Disposal of Old Coolant
Never dump old coolant down the drain or in the garbage. Engine coolant is toxic to humans and animals. It’s also bad for the environment. Most places have laws against this.
Call your local automotive shop or recycling center. Many accept old coolant for free or a small fee. Some places actually want it since it can be recycled and reused. Your turkey baster doesn’t have to go in the trash either. Rinse it thoroughly and let it dry.
Common Mistakes to Avoid
Don’t mix coolant types. Mixing green with orange creates chemical reactions. These reactions produce sludge and reduce cooling system efficiency. Always drain completely and use one type throughout.
Don’t skip the rinsing step. People rush this and put fresh coolant into a still-dirty reservoir. The new coolant gets contaminated immediately. Takes weeks for problems to show up.
Don’t work on a hot engine. Seriously. Hot coolant under pressure can spray out and burn you badly. Always wait for everything to cool first.
Don’t forget to dispose of old coolant properly. Environmental damage isn’t worth saving a few bucks. Do the right thing.
When to Call a Professional
Some cars have complicated cooling systems. Hybrid vehicles often have extra water pumps and electric cooling fans. Luxury cars might have multiple reservoirs and custom configurations.
If your car is under warranty, check your manual before doing this yourself. Some warranties get voided by DIY maintenance. It’s not worth the risk.
If you find leaks after refilling, stop and call a mechanic. Leaks mean bigger problems than just a dirty reservoir. Gaskets might be worn. Hoses might need replacing. Professional help saves you from making things worse.
Maintenance Tips Going Forward
Your cooling system isn’t a one-and-done thing. Keep it healthy long term. Check your coolant level every month when your engine is cold. Look for color changes. Coolant should stay its original color. Discoloration means breakdown is happening.
Every few years, do this cleaning process again. The exact interval depends on your car and driving conditions. Hot climates cause faster degradation. Stop-and-go city driving creates more buildup than highway cruising.
Use quality coolant from trusted brands. Cheap coolant fails faster. You’ll be doing this job again sooner than you’d like.
Pay attention to temperature warning lights. Your dashboard tells you when something’s wrong. A creeping temperature gauge means your cooling system is struggling. Clean that reservoir before you have serious problems.
